a group or chain of islands clustered together in a sea or ocean
|
archipelago
|
|
a body of water that is partly enclosed by land (and is usually smaller than a gulf)
|
bay
|
|
a pointed piece of land that sticks out into a sea, ocean, lake, or river
|
cape
|
|
small, horseshoe-shaped body of water along the coast; the water is surrounded by land formed of soft rock.
|
cove
|
|
a low, watery land formed at the mouth of a river. It is formed from the silt, sand and small rocks that flow downstream in the river.
|
delta
|
|
an imaginary circle around the earth, halfway between the north and south poles.
|
equator
|
|
where a river meets the sea or ocean.
|
estuary
|
|
a part of the ocean (or sea) that is partly surrounded by land (it is usually larger than a bay).
|
gulf
|
|
a narrow strip of land connecting two larger landmasses with water on two sides
|
isthmus
|
|
Imaginary lines that run horizontal. Is the distance north or south from the equator.
|
latitude
|
|
Imaginary lines that run vertical. Is the angular distance east or west from the Prime Meridian.
|
longitude
|
|
a body of land that is surrounded by water on three sides
|
peninsula
|
|
a wide inlet of the sea or ocean that is parallel to the coastline; it often separates a coastline from a nearby island
|
sound
|
|
a narrow body of water that connects two larger bodies of water
|
strait
|
|
a stream or river that flows into a larger river
|
tributary
